Jonathan Anderson’s On Foot Exhibition

Jonathan Anderson, the renowned designer behind JW Anderson and Loewe, is set to showcase his curation skills with a new art dialogue exhibition titled “On Foot.” The exhibition will take place at Mayfair gallery Offer Waterman and is scheduled to open on September 18, coinciding with the Frieze Art Fair 2023.

Offer Waterman, a well-established gallery and art dealer located in a Georgian townhouse, will serve as the backdrop for Anderson’s exhibition. The event will bring together contemporary artists and iconic works of modern British art, including Anderson’s own fashion designs for JW Anderson and Loewe. Anderson envisions the exhibition as an opportunity for visitors to fully immerse themselves in the artworks and experience them as both viewers and bystanders.

The exhibition will center around recent fashion seasons and explore the transformation of the body through sculptural designs. Drawing inspiration from the city of London, the exhibition will unfold like a walk-through, capturing the contrasting elements and surprising juxtapositions found in the city. Anderson plans to juxtapose the elegant streets of Mayfair with the intriguing alleys of Soho, where the JW Anderson store is situated.

The lineup of artists featured in “On Foot” is extensive and diverse, including prominent names like Igshaan Adams, Frank Auerbach, Lucian Freud, David Hockney, and Barbara Hepworth, among others. The exhibition aims to celebrate all aspects of the city, from its lively pubs to tranquil parks. Corridors and staircases will be transformed into bustling streets and pavements, with ceramic and sculptures depicting crowded scenes. Additionally, JW Anderson’s iconic pigeons will occupy a storeroom and a garden square bench.

As a special collaboration for the exhibition, Anthea Hamilton has worked with JW Anderson to create a limited-edition version of the iconic pigeon clutch. This exclusive piece will be showcased at Offer Waterman and the JW Anderson Soho store.

“On Foot” follows Anderson’s previous experience as a curator with “Disobedient Bodies” at the Hayward Gallery. The exhibition brought together sculptures by renowned artists like Barbara Hepworth, Henry Moore, and Louise Bourgeois, along with works from fashion designers like Jean-Paul Gaultier, Helmut Lang, and Rei Kawakubo. With “On Foot,” Anderson continues his exploration of the intersection between art and fashion, fostering a unique dialogue between the two disciplines.
